Why North Boulder City, NV Homes Need Professional Glass Cleaning
Window maintenance is challenging due to the desert environment. North Boulder City, NV enjoys lots of sunshine. These cleaners dry out fast and leave behind streaks and spots. The presence of calcium and magnesium make the region's water hard. When water evaporates on glass, the minerals left behind can be tough to eliminate as they damage the glass.
Windows are always accumulating dust and sand from the desert area. Wind storms leave behind finely textured particles that work like abrasives. Regular professional cleaning prevents glass from becoming scratched by particles. Affordable home window cleaning use specialized equipment and techniques to remove dirt without damaging surfaces.
Safety is another issue. Numerous North Boulder City, NV homes showcase grand two-story structures with oversized windows for maximum views. Cleaning windows on the upper floor from ladders involves a considerable risk of falling. Every safety standard relating to working at heights is followed . They are insured and trained so that both the workers and homeowners are safe.
Even glass, when clean, can improve energy efficiency. Dirty windows block natural light and require more artificial lighting. Low-emissivity coatings on contemporary windows have their efficiency hampered by mineral deposits. Cleaning keeps the energy efficiency optimal

Regular clean up of external & internal surfaces.
We wash both sides of all accessible windows. Technicians take off the screens, clean them separately, and replace properly. They clean the sills and tracks of dirt. Standard cleaning is for homes that don’t have severe staining or buildup.
Removing Hard Water Stains.
Tough hard water stains are produced in desert climates one of the toughest in the nation. Acidic solutions or polishing compounds can be used for dissolving buildups by professionals. Solutions with vinegar make calcium and magnesium build up go away. To eliminate intense glass etching, technicians use glass restoration to polish the surface. Although it’s more costly than your usual cleaning, this service offers a level of clarity you can’t get from home.
Detailing of screen and track
Screens trap dust and pollen that eventually gets transferred to glass. Washing of screens after removing them with suitable solutions and allowing them to dry before replacing. Track cleaning eliminates dirt and debris that interfere with window operation and frame damage.
Assistance with high-rise and multi-storey.
Second stories and higher windows need special equipment for homes. Cleaning from the ground can happen with water-fed pole systems. When rooflines become complex or a third-story access is necessary, technicians may need rope descent systems as allowed under OSHA 1910.27. These systems need roof anchors that are certified to support 5000 pounds.

The Professional Cleaning Process
By learning more about how Affordable home window cleaning work, you can help evaluate contractor quality as well as prepare your home for them.
Stage 1 – Assessment and Quotation.
Technicians examine your windows for hard water damage, the condition of the screens, and access difficulties. The number of panes, stories and special requirements are noted. Reputable companies provide written estimates based on the assessment, not a vague one.
Prepping next Steps
The crew safeguard your flooring and furniture with cloths. The obstacles get moved from the windows. They check ladders and equipment to ensure safety compliance. If rope descent systems are necessary for multi-story work, they check roof anchor credentials.
Removal and cleaning of screen.
Technicians take out all the displays to avoid damaging the frame. They clean displays thoroughly with detergents. Before replacing screens, ensure they dry completely to prevent water spots on glass.
Fourth Step: Cleaning The Glass.
Exterior cleaning equipment utilizes water fed pole systems with purified water. As there are no solids in water, mineral residues are absent in this method. Interior cleaning uses squeegees and store-grade solutions that will not streak. Technicians always start from above and work to the bottom.
Tough Water Therapy is Stage 5.
In houses containing mineral deposits, technicians use acidic solutions or polishing compound. They provide adequate time for the chemicals to dissolve deposits. They make glass shiny again. Prior training essential to prevent harming seals and frames.
Step 6: Conclusion and Cleaning Up.
Quality companies examine each window from various angles to catch streaks or missed spots. They carefully and thoroughly clean sills and tracks. They replace screens properly and make windows work correctly. Our crews take all the equipment and leave your home cleaner than we found it.

Understanding Costs in the North Boulder City, NV Market
The cost of Affordable home window cleaning is dependent on various factors. Knowing these helps you plan your budgets and compare prices.
Standard window cleaning in Boulder City, NV area costs between $6.30 and $8.30 per pane for inside and out service. A standard size and condition house with a single family costs $250 to $400. The prices take into account the specialized equipment needed in desert conditions.
The size of a home affects price significantly. A modest, single-story home may have 20-30 panes. Multi-story houses featuring big glass walls can have more than 100 panes. Most companies charge per pane, or charge a flat rate based on the size of the home.
The cost of hard water stain removal comes to $10 to $15 more per glass pane depending on severity. The cost of glass restoration does not come cheap. Regular cleanings can save you money.
Affordability Challenges Increase Costs. Windows that are obstructed by landscaping, above delicate surfaces, or needing a ladder will take longer. Additional safety equipment and time needed for second and third stories.
Changes to the frequency may alter per-visit pricing. Many companies will offer discounts for quarterly service agreements. Regular clients get priority scheduling and sometimes a lower fee for maintenance cleans versus the one-off deep cleans.
A standard North Boulder City, NV home will cost around $250 to $400 for a complete interior and exterior clean. Adding services like hard water treatment, screen cleaning, and track detailing can charge $100 to $200 more. The cost may exceed $500 or more for high-rise or heavily stained homes.

What makes water stains on my windows hard?
The water in North Boulder City, NV is hard with very high mineral content. Calcium and magnesium deposits are left on the glass when water evaporates. The scorching heat of the desert causes these minerals to be baked onto the surface. Thus, removal is difficult for a general person without professional treatment.

Do you wash the windows during summer?
Certainly, the right timing is essential. Our technicians work at early hours to avoid peak heat. Tactics that slow the quick drying of solutions are used. When done properly, the heat in the desert is good for helping windows dry without streaks.
What can I do to get the windows cleaned?
Take delicate objects off window ledges. Ensure windows can open freely by moving furniture. If possible, unlock all windows. To ensure the glass dries out fully, it’s best to keep your sprinkler systems off a full 24 hours before we arrive for our service.
Is cleaning windows with security screens possible?
Security screens need special handling. Some firms pull them and clean them; others clean around them. When you’re getting the quote you should discuss the handling the security screens because this will affect the cost and time involved.
